Thursday, September 4, 7:32 PM
Tampa Bay Buccaneers wide receiver Chris Godwin (ankle) remained absent from practice for the second straight day on Thursday heading into the Week 1 season opener this Sunday against the division-rival Atlanta Falcons. Although Godwin avoided the Physically Unable to Perform list to open the regular season, he will inevitably be ruled out for Week 1 on Friday and may not be able to make his 2025 debut until Week 5 or later after disclocating his ankle in Week 7 of last year. The 29-year-old figures to be a big part of Tampa's passing attack whenever he makes his way back, which makes him worth stashing in an IR spot in all fantasy formats, but it's probably going to be a while before we see Godwin back on the field. In the meantime, rookie first-rounder Emeka Egbuka should be an every-week starter in fantasy as the WR2 behind Mike Evans.

Thursday, August 7, 5:21 PM
New York Giants wide receiver Wan'Dale Robinson (leg) is participating in team portions of practice after being limited by a minor leg injury earlier in camp. The fourth-year wideout is expected to be the Giants' primary slot receiver this season. Robinson played in all 17 games for New York in 2024, recording 93 receptions for 699 yards and three touchdowns. As evidenced by his 7.5-yard-per-reception average, Robinson was almost exclusively utilized as a short-area target last season. As a result, he profiles much more favorably in PPR-scoring fantasy formats.
